Learn how to play Pips

When you’ve ever performed dominoes, you will have a passing familiarity for the way Pips is performed. As we have shared in our earlier hints tales for Pips, the tiles, like dominoes, are positioned vertically or horizontally and join with one another. The principle distinction between a conventional sport of dominoes and Pips is the color-coded circumstances it’s important to deal with. The touching tiles do not essentially should match.

The circumstances it’s important to meet are particular to the color-coded areas. For instance, if it gives a single quantity, each aspect of a tile in that house should add as much as the quantity offered. It’s attainable – and customary – for under half a tile to be inside a color-coded house.

Listed here are widespread examples you will run into throughout the problem ranges:

  • Quantity: All of the pips on this house should add as much as the quantity.

  • Equal: Each domino half on this house have to be the identical variety of pips.

  • Not Equal: Each domino half on this house should have a very totally different variety of pips.

  • Lower than: Each domino half on this house should add as much as lower than the quantity.

  • Better than: Each domino half on this house should add as much as greater than the quantity.

If an space doesn’t have any shade coding, it means there are not any circumstances on the parts of dominoes inside these areas.
